  Job Description:

  This role is responsible for engaging clients in the lobby to educate and assist with conducting transactions through self-service resources such as mobile banking, online banking, or ATM. This role also accurately and efficiently processes cash transactions for clients as needed. Relationship bankers have deep conversations with clients to gain in-depth knowledge of their financial and life priorities.

  A Relationship Banker (responsibilities):

  • Executes the bank's risk culture and strives for operational excellence

  • Builds relationships with individual clients to meet their financial needs

  • Follows established processes and guidelines in daily activities to do what is right for clients and the bank, adhering to all applicable laws and regulations

  • Grows business knowledge and network by partnering with experts in small business, lending and investments

  • Manages financial center traffic, appointments and outbound calls effectively

  • Drives the client experience

  • Manages cash responsibilities

  You're a person who (required skills):

  • Is an enthusiastic, highly motivated self-starter with a strong work ethic and intense focus on results, acting in the best interest of the client.

  • Collaborates effectively to get things done, building and nurturing strong relationships.

  • Displays passion, commitment and drive to deliver an experience that improves our clients' financial lives.

  • Is confident in identifying solutions for new and existing clients based on their needs.

  • Communicates effectively and confidently, and is comfortable engaging all clients.

  • Has the ability to learn and adapt to new information and technology platforms.

  • Is confident in educating clients on how to conduct simple banking transactions through self-service technologies (for example, ATM, online banking, mobile banking).

  • Applies strong critical thinking and problem-solving skills to meet clients' needs.

  • Will follow established processes and guidelines in daily activities to do what is right for clients and the bank, adhering to all applicable laws and regulations.

  • Efficiently manages your time and capacity.

  • Focuses on results, while acting in the best interest of the client.

  • Can be flexible to work weekends and/or extended hours as needed.

  You'll be more prepared if you have (desired skills):

  • Experience in financial services and knowledge of financial services industry, products and solutions.

  • One year of demonstrated successful sales experience in a salary plus incentive environment with individual sales goals.

  • Six months of cash handling experience.

  • Bachelor's degree or business relevant associate degree such as business management, business administration, or finance.
